Output 1018a58190504e0377c140028b8d0cc7ed84465977bc817252fd65b1871f7b68:0

value
16747614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 629568c3f1ac2b96fb248686c113b3a3040636c9 OP_EQUAL
address
3AgH8UjzexeENvVMQPQRVMfuqnLZ8sAiAa
transaction
1018a58190504e0377c140028b8d0cc7ed84465977bc817252fd65b1871f7b68
spent
true